Sunteți pe pagina 1din 10

¿Para qué es utilizado el Registro Status?

a. Para almacenar información referente al modo de Trabajo del procesador y el estado de


las interrupciones.
b. Para el procesamiento de las excepciones de en el procesador MIPS32.
c. Ahí se encuentran los registros necesarios para el tratamiento de excepciones.
d. Obliga al procesador a encargarse de revisar el estado de los dispositivos de entrada y
salida.

¿Para qué es utilizado el Registro Cause?

a. Para almacenar el código de la última excepción o interrupción generada.


b. Para habilitar o enmascarar cada uno de los niveles de prioridad.
c. Se escribe un valor de dicha posición de memoria.
d. Permite la introducción de caracteres desde teclado.

¿Por qué se producen excepciones de carga?

a. Por errores que ocurren durante la ejecución de una instrucción o son generados por
instrucciones específicas.
b. Por cargar la nueva rutina de tratamiento de excepciones
c. Por qué el contenido alcanza el valor máximo en el registro.
d. Por la ejecución de una instrucción que provee la excepción

¿Por qué se produce el desbordamiento de una operación aritmética?

a. Cuando no puede ser correctamente representado


b. Por qué se almacena en un registro determinado
c. Por acceder a un dato en el bloque de activación
d. Por qué se almacena temporalmente dicha información

¿Qué es el registro Count?

a. Es un contador ascendente no cíclico que incrementa su valor en una unidad cada 10


milisegundos.
b. dispositivo capaz de generar interrupciones.
c. Son errores de desbordamiento y de direccionamiento erróneo.
d. Es una excepción por desbordamiento.

¿Cuál es el objetivo de Tratamiento de interrupciones simultaneas?

 Es el de mostrar cómo se pueden gestionar las ´ interrupciones producidas por dos


dispositivos de forma simultánea.
 Es una nueva modificación del código de la rutina de tratamiento de excepciones.
 Es gestionar los dispositivos de entrada/salida por medio de interrupciones.
 Es el permitir ser instruidos sobre si deben generar o no interrupciones.

¿En qué consiste la habilitación de las interrupciones?


 Consiste en la habilitación de las interrupciones, tanto en los dispositivos como en el
procesador.
 Esta es tratada por la rutina de tratamiento de excepciones.
 La gestión de interrupciones generadas simultáneamente por el teclado y la pantalla.
 Tiene por objeto capturar la interrupción del teclado y gestionar la entrada de datos (del
teclado) por interrupciones.

¿En qué consiste Identificación de la causa de la interrupción (reloj o teclado)?

 Consiste en incluir en la rutina de tratamiento de excepciones el código necesario para


determinar la causa de la interrupción para entonces saltar a la parte de código
correspondiente.
 Programar el reloj para que genere interrupciones periódicas.
 Habilitar las interrupciones en el teclado
 Desarrollo del código que deber a tratar la interrupción de reloj y ´ retornar al proceso
interrumpido

¿En qué consiste Procesamiento de las interrupciones?

 Consiste en codificar las operaciones que se deben llevar a cabo para el tratamiento de
cada una de dichas interrupciones.
 La identificación de la causa de la interrupción: teclado o pantalla.
 El procesamiento adecuado de cada una de dichas interrupciones, la de teclado y la de
pantalla.
 Consiste en incluir en la rutina de tratamiento de excepciones el código necesario ´ para
determinar la causa de la interrupción para entonces saltar a la parte ´ de código
correspondiente.

¿A qué se refiere El tratamiento de la excepción propiamente dicho?

 A partir de este momento se lleva a cabo la ejecución de la rutina de tratamiento de


excepciones.
 si la excepción se ha producido al intentar ejecutar una determinada instrucción, se
almacena la dirección de la instrucción causante de la excepción
 a introducir las operaciones aritméticas que el MIPS32
 Las operaciones aritméticas en las que uno de los operandos es una constante aparecen
con relativa frecuencia

¿Qué significa las siglas RAID?

 RANDOM ACCESS INSTA DISC


 REDUNDANT ARRAY INDEPENDENT DISC
 ROUTE ACCES INDEPENDENT DISC
 READ ADDRES INDEPENDENT DISC

RAID ES:
 El método que se usa para expandir la capacidad de almacenado en el disco interno.
 EL método que se usa para expandir la memoria RAM.
 El método que se usa para expandir información en diversos discos.
 El método que se usa para tener una mejor cobertura en el procesador.

¿Cuál es la finalidad de la técnica de particionado?

 La información se distribuye parcialmente en los discos.


 La información se inserta en los discos simultáneamente.
 Se define una función que recupera información en caso de pérdida.
 Se define un paquete de datos que tendrá la información completa de los datos.

¿Cuál es la finalidad de la técnica de duplicado?

 La información se distribuye parcialmente en los discos.


 La información se inserta en los discos simultáneamente.
 Se define una función que recupera información en caso de pérdida.
 Se define un paquete de datos que tendrá la información completa de los datos.

¿Cuál es la finalidad de la técnica de pariedad?

 La información se distribuye parcialmente en los discos.


 La información se inserta en los discos simultáneamente.
 Se define una función que recupera información en caso de pérdida.
 Se define un paquete de datos que tendrá la información completa de los datos.

¿Qué técnicas de distribución de información permite RAID 0?

 Pariedad
 Duplicado
 Particionado
 Todas las anteriores

¿Qué técnicas de distribución de información permite RAID 1?

 Pariedad
 Duplicado
 Particionado
 Todas las anteriores

¿Qué técnicas de distribución de información permite RAID 5?

 Pariedad
 Duplicado
 Particionado
 Todas las anteriores

Los RAID 2,3,4:

 Son una evolución de RAID 1.


 Actualmente no se utilizan.
 Son comunes en la gestión de información de empresas.
 Son los tipos de RAID que más velocidad de procesamiento tienen.

¿Cuáles son las dos posibles formas para usar RAID?

 Hardware/Software
 Local/Linea
 Bytes/Paquetes
 Cliente/Servidor

Como se conoce a los errores que ocurren durante una ejecución de una instrucción o son
generados por instrucciones específicas?

A) excepciones de software

b) excepciones hardware

c) excepción de hardware y software

d) ninguna de las anteriores

Seleccione las causas más conocidas que producen una excepción del software

A) desbordamiento aritmético

b) error de direccionamiento

c) ejecución de una instrucción ilegal

d) todas las anteriores

a que se le conoce como un desbordamiento por excepción

a) Se le conoce como un desbordamiento cunado en una operación aritmética el resultado no


puede ser correctamente presentado

b) Se le conoce como desbordamiento cuando la instrucción se ejecuta correctamente

c) Se le conoce como desbordamiento cuando la subrutina no es declarada correctamente.

Para describir los procesos que lleva acabo una excepción que momentos se debe considerar?

a) el instante en el que se producen

b) el instante en el que el procesador decide tratar la excepción

c) el tratamiento de las excepciones propiamente dichas

d) todas las anteriores

Que realiza el registro cause?

a) Almacena el código de la última excepción o interrupción generada


b) Almacena el código de la primera excepción o interrupción generada

Almacena el código de la segunda excepción o interrupción generada

Almacena el código de la tercera excepción o interrupción generada

Escoger la opción correcta:

A)Periféricos de salida 1)Discos duros, pantallas táctiles

B)Periféricos de entrada 2)Monitores, impresoras

C)Periféricos de entrada/salida 3)Teclados y escáneres

a)A,2-B,3-C,1

b)A,3-B,2-C,1

c)A,2-B,1-C,3

d)A,3-B,1,C,2

Donde se ubica el puerto de datos para la entrada desde teclado:

a)0xffff0000

b)0xffff000c

c)0xffff0004

d)0xffff000d

En qué dirección se ubica la salida de datos por la consola:

a)0xffff0000

b)0xffff000c

c)0xffff0004

d)0xffff000d

Que función realiza el registro de control

a. Indica al controlador que operación de entrada y salida se debe realizar.


b. Almacena los estados de los periféricos.
c. Facilitan la comunicación del procesador.

Que función realiza el registro de datos

a. Almacena el dato que se va intercambiar con el periférico durante la operación de E/S.


b. Realiza la introducción por caracteres desde el teclado del computador.
c. Registro de solo lectura.

De las cuatro categorías de la Taxonomía de Flynn, cual puede tener una ejecución sincrónica,
asincrónica, determinística o no-determinística.
 SISD
 SIMD
 MISD
 MIMD

La ___________ del espacio de direcciones de memoria se divide en: ______y ______

 Organización – Estática – Dinámica


 Arquitectura – Estática – Dinámica
 Organización – Lógica – Física
 Arquitectura – Lógica – Física

Son periféricos de Entrada de una Computadora

 micrófono, impresora, bocinas


 escaner, monitor, teclado, wep-cam, audifonos
 webcam, microfono, teclado, mouse, escaner
 bocinas, impresora, monitor

¿Cuales de los siguientes son Perifericos de Salida?

 escaner, monitor, teclado, mouse


 bosinas, impresora, monitor, audifonos
 monitor, bocinas, teclado, mouse
 escáner, micrófono, teclado, mouse

Una secuencia de datos única es provista a...

a) Unidades de procesamiento múltiples (Correcta)

b) Una única unidad de procesamiento

c) A la memoria RAM

d) A una unidad de almacenamiento interna

Una ejecución puede ser...

a) Almacenada o por lotes

b) Coherente o Incoherente

c) Sincrónica o Asincrónica (Correcta)

d) Fundamental o de rutina

En la Aparición de procesadores o sistemas vectoriales se define como :

• Como flujos de datos e instrucciones


• El concepto es paralelismo por segmentación

• Mantener elementos útiles de clasificación de Flynn

En cuál de los siguientes puntos se defina “En la clasificación que atiende el flujo de datos”

• Probablemente

• Basada

• Flujo de instrucciones

Un sistema paralelo tiene como característica principal:

 Forma de comunicación entre los elementos de proceso con un alto rendimiento y


escalabilidad del sistema.
 Son la distribución de datos en diferentes nodos para que se procesen en paralelo, sus
tareas son comunes y solo tiene un resultado.
 Se adapta muy bien en problemas con un alto grado de regularidad, tales como
gráficos/imágenes.
 La ejecución puede ser sincrónica o asincrónica, determinística o no-determinística.

¿Cuál es la idea básica de la computación paralela?

 Consta de un conjunto de computadoras independientes, interconectadas entre sí, de tal


manera que funcionan como un solo recurso computacional.
 La coherencia de cache hace referencia a la integridad de los datos almacenados en las
caches locales de los recursos compartidos.
 Es cuando se aumenta el tamaño de una palabra en la computadoras esto reduce el
número de instrucciones que el procesador.
 Es que varios dispositivos se ejecutan simultáneamente y coordinadamente las tareas,
pueden rendir más que un único dispositivo, y se pueden clasificar según el nivel de
paralelismo que admite su hardware.

¿Cuántos REGISTROS TIENE EL PROCESADOR?

A_3

B_2

C_MAS DE 4

D_NINGUNO

¿Cuál DE LAS SIGUIENTES OPCIONES NO PERTENECE A LOS REGISTROS

A_REGISTRO DE CONTROL

B_REGISTRO DE DATOS
C_REGISTRO DE ESTADO

D-REGISTRO DE E/S

CUAL ES EL PRINCIPAL OBJETIVO DEL PROCESAMIENTO EN PARALELO

a) Disminución en el Rendimiento
b) Aumento de la capacidad para resolver problemas computacionales grandes.
c) Incrementa el número de procesadores.
d) Escalabilidad del sistema

ESCOGA UNA LIMITACIÓN DEL PROCESAMIENTO EN PARALELO

a) Se minimiza la interacción entre tareas: se minimiza la comunicación o, al menos, se


mejoran los canales de comunicación.
b) No se logra un balance de carga entre procesadores.
c) El incremento del número de procesadores mejora el rendimiento global.
d) La interacción es lograda a través de un conjunto de lecturas.

Seleccione la dirección correcta del registro de datos.

a)00xFFFD00C

b)0xFFFD000C

c)0xFFFDC000

d)0x0FFFD00C

Seleccione la dirección correcta del registro de estado.

a)0xFFFD0009

b)0xFFFD0007

c)0xFFFD0005

d)0xFFFD0008

Una Característica de multiprocesadores es:


1) PERMITE EL ACCESO CONCURRENTE DE VARIOS PROCESADORES.

2) No permite el acceso a la memoria

3) Es que son datos almacenados.

4) Ninguna de las anteriores

La coherencia del cache hace referencia a:


1) A LA INTEGRIDAD DE LOS DATOS ALMACENADOS EN LOS CACHES LOCALES DE LOS
RECURSOS COMPARTIDOS.

2) La memoria compartida del cache.


3) Los datos que no están almacenados en los recursos compartidos.

4) El sistema de procesamiento paralelo o distribuido.

¿Que es el SISD?

*Es una instrucción simple que consiste en una ejecucion por el CPU durante un ciclo de reloj.
(RESPUESTA)

*Es un mecanismo con pocas instrucciones.

*Es una ejecución sincrónica y determinística.

*Es una computadora paralela.

¿Qué es el SIMD?

*Computadora Simple que tiene ejecución sincrónica y determinística.

*Computadora Paralela que tiene ejecución sincrónica y determinística. (CORRECTA)

*Consiste en datos simples en ciclos de reloj.

*Es una computadora sin paralelismo.

El aumento del tamaño de la palabra reduce el número de instrucciones que el procesador debe
ejecutar para realizar una operación en variables cuyos tamaños son mayores que la longitud de
la palabra. Esto ocurre en:

 Paralelismo a nivel de bit


 Paralelismo a nivel de instrucción
 Paralelismo de datos
 Paralelismo de tareas

Cuando cada procesador ejecuta una diferente tarea. Se lo conoce como:

 Paralelismo a nivel de instrucción


 Paralelismo de datos
 Paralelismo de tareas
 Paralelismo a nivel de bit

S-ar putea să vă placă și